At its heart, "Starmaker Story" capitalizes on a ubiquitous cultural fantasy: the desire to be the architect of a star. Unlike games where the player is the performer, here the player assumes the role of the "starmaker"—the manager, producer, or agent. This shift in perspective is significant; it reframes the game’s objective from personal glory to strategic manipulation. The player is tasked with discovering raw talent, honing their skills, and navigating the treacherous waters of public relations.
